Transaction 299ec75ceb8c15a02f2adecf86161c84993f3e84900b08fe1100b20bc3f2dcfa
1 Input
1 Output
-
299ec75ceb8c15a02f2adecf86161c84993f3e84900b08fe1100b20bc3f2dcfa:0
- value
- 72156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a68a30ab6e6ed51c4f4357d4deacc21832af8aba OP_EQUAL
- address
- 3Gsbe1FgDMkR6faqPsPEXNpkSDnWh83h5j